The Pros and Cons of Booking Hotels Directly vs. By Third-Party Sites

When planning a trip, one of the crucial necessary choices travelers face is find out how to book their accommodation. With countless options available on-line, it’s tempting to rely on third-party sites like Expedia, Booking.com, or Agoda. Nonetheless, booking directly with a hotel also has its advantages. Every option presents its own set of benefits and drawbacks, and understanding them will help you make probably the most informed choice in your subsequent trip.

Pros of Booking Hotels Directly

1. Higher Customer Service

If you book directly with a hotel, you’re more likely to receive personalized buyer service. Hotel staff can access your reservation details and make adjustments more easily. When you’ve got specific preferences, akin to room upgrades, late check-ins, or particular amenities, direct communication with the hotel will increase your chances of having those requests accommodated.

2. Loyalty Programs and Perks

Many hotel chains provide rewards programs that provide free nights, room upgrades, or discounts. These benefits are usually only available when booking directly. Over time, these loyalty perks can add up significantly, particularly for frequent travelers.

3. Versatile Cancellation Policies

Hotels typically offer more lenient cancellation policies for direct bookings. While third-party platforms could have rigid or non-refundable conditions, booking directly may provide more flexibility in case of adjustments to your journey plans.

4. No Hidden Charges

Direct bookings often provide transparent pricing. Third-party sites typically embody hidden charges or service charges that aren’t clearly displayed until the ultimate checkout page. Booking directly helps keep away from these surprises.

Cons of Booking Hotels Directly

1. Time-Consuming Comparisons

One downside of booking directly is that it requires more time to match prices and presents across multiple hotel websites. Unlike third-party platforms, you won’t see different options side by side.

2. Missed Bundled Deals

Third-party platforms typically provide package deals that embrace flights, rental cars, and hotels at a reduced rate. By booking directly with the hotel, you might miss out on these cost-saving bundles.

3. Smaller Collection of Properties

Not each lodging option has its own booking platform. Small boutique hotels, hostels, or independent properties could not support direct booking, limiting your decisions if you happen to keep away from third-party platforms altogether.

Pros of Booking By Third-Party Sites

1. Comfort and Speed

Third-party booking websites are designed for convenience. They assist you to compare a wide range of hotels, prices, amenities, and guest reviews multi function place. This streamlined process saves time and makes it simpler to find lodging within your budget.

2. Access to Evaluations and Scores

Most third-party booking sites function user-generated evaluations and star ratings. These insights provide a more comprehensive picture of the hotel experience, helping you make a more informed decision.

3. Promotions and Exclusive Reductions

Journey sites regularly supply flash sales, promo codes, and particular reductions not available elsewhere. These offers can lead to significant savings, particularly for budget-acutely aware travelers.

4. Booking Multiple Services Collectively

Many third-party platforms assist you to bundle hotel bookings with flights, automotive leases, and travel insurance. These mixtures should not only handy however typically more affordable.

Cons of Booking Via Third-Party Sites

1. Limited Buyer Help

If something goes mistaken with your reservation, resolving points through a third-party site could be frustrating. Hotels could also be limited in what they will do to assist for the reason that booking wasn’t made directly with them.

2. Restrictive Policies

Third-party bookings often come with stricter terms and conditions. Changes, cancellations, or refunds will be more difficult, and you could end up paying more in case your plans shift unexpectedly.

3. Hidden Expenses

Some journey sites add service charges or resort fees that will not be clearly displayed upfront. This can lead to a closing bill that’s higher than expected.

Each methods of hotel booking have distinct advantages and disadvantages. Your selection in the end depends on your travel wants, flexibility, and personal preferences. Whether or not you prioritize customer service and perks or value convenience and selection, understanding the trade-offs may also help you book smarter and travel better.
